// Copyright (C) 2023 Luke Shumaker <lukeshu@lukeshu.com>
//
// SPDX-License-Identifier: GPL-2.0-or-later
package btrfssum_test
import (
"bytes"
"testing"
"git.lukeshu.com/go/lowmemjson"
"github.com/stretchr/testify/assert"
"git.lukeshu.com/btrfs-progs-ng/lib/btrfs/btrfssum"
)
func TestShortSumEncodeJSON(t *testing.T) {
t.Parallel()
type TestCase struct {
InputSum btrfssum.ShortSum
OutputJSON string
}
testcases := map[string]TestCase{
"short": {
InputSum: "xyz",
OutputJSON: `"78797a"`,
},
"long": {
InputSum: "0123456789abcdefghijklmnopqrstuvwxyz;:.,ABCDEFG",
OutputJSON: `["303132333435363738396162636465666768696a6b6c6d6e6f707172737475767778797a3b3a2e2c","41424344454647"]`,
},
"medium": { // exactly the maximum string length
InputSum: "0123456789abcdefghijklmnopqrstuvwxyz;:.,",
OutputJSON: `"303132333435363738396162636465666768696a6b6c6d6e6f707172737475767778797a3b3a2e2c"`,
},
}
for tcName, tc := range testcases {
tc := tc
t.Run(tcName, func(t *testing.T) {
t.Parallel()
var jsonBuf bytes.Buffer
assert.NoError(t, lowmemjson.NewEncoder(&jsonBuf).Encode(tc.InputSum))
assert.Equal(t, tc.OutputJSON, jsonBuf.String())
var rtSum btrfssum.ShortSum
assert.NoError(t, lowmemjson.NewDecoder(&jsonBuf).DecodeThenEOF(&rtSum))
assert.Equal(t, tc.InputSum, rtSum)
})
}
}
func FuzzShortSumJSONFuzz(f *testing.F) {
f.Fuzz(func(t *testing.T, _inSum []byte) {
t.Logf("in = %q", _inSum)
inSum := btrfssum.ShortSum(_inSum)
var jsonBuf bytes.Buffer
assert.NoError(t, lowmemjson.NewEncoder(&jsonBuf).Encode(inSum))
t.Logf("json = %q", jsonBuf.Bytes())
var outSum btrfssum.ShortSum
assert.NoError(t, lowmemjson.NewDecoder(&jsonBuf).DecodeThenEOF(&outSum))
assert.Equal(t, inSum, outSum)
})
}
